Delegation
Functions as part of nursing
team; able to describe and
begin to use 5 Rights of
Delegation when delegating to
UAP:
Readily able to delegate to
UAP according to the 5 Rights
of Delegation.
Recognizes and values
interdependent relationships.
Adaptable, flexible, and
consistently effective in
delegation.
- Right task
- Right circumstances
- Right person
- Right communication
- Right supervision and
evaluation
